About AvantStay

AvantStay offers a hospitality platform focused on short-term rentals, providing tailored experiences for guests. The company uses its own technology to manage bookings and operations, both on-site and remotely. With a presence in over 150 cities and a portfolio of 2,000 luxury properties, AvantStay partners with major platforms like Homes & Villas by Marriott International and facilitates direct bookings through more than 60 online travel agencies (OTAs). Unlike many competitors, AvantStay emphasizes curated experiences and a strong tech infrastructure to enhance guest interactions. The company's goal is to redefine the short-term rental market by delivering high-quality, personalized stays for travelers.

Risks

Increased competition in the luxury short-term rental market may impact AvantStay's market share.
Recent layoffs may indicate financial instability or operational challenges at AvantStay.
Expansion into new markets may strain resources and lead to integration challenges.
